Description

Dillon XL 750 5 station progressive loader – No Caliber Conversion Kit installed. You will need dies and a caliber conversion kit as they are not included with this machine. The Dillon XL750 is a high-speed progressive reloading machine designed to load the common rifle and handgun cartridges, from 17 Hornet though the common belted magnum cartridges in rifle, and 32 ACP through 500 S&W in handgun. Machine height from the bench is 32" without the optional electric case feeder, 38 1/2" with the electric casefeeder installed. Automatically indexed Shellplate rotates one station with each pull of the handle. Mechanically inserted cases, manually fed bullets. Casefeed tube to automatically insert cases. The Casefeed motor can be added to automatically insert cases into the Casefeed tube. (Motor not included with the base machine.) No dies are included with the XL750. Dies are purchased separately. Includes:1 powder measure with standard large and small powder bars (small bar installed). The small bar throws from 2.1 to 15 grains of powder. The large bar throws from 15 to 55 grains of extruded powder or up to 60 grains of ball/spherical type powder.1 primer system with large and small priming parts (appropriate size installed).1 large and one small primer pick-up tube.Low Primer Alarm 1 loaded cartridge bin1 toolhead1 powder die1 set of standard Allen wrenchesMachine pictured shows available options. These are not included with the base machine. (These items have been grayed out in the picture.) Items NOT included: Electric Case Feeder Powder Check Die Aluminum Roller Handle Bullet Tray Strong Mount Low Powder Alarm&n

  • Ammo FACTORY in your man/woman cave
This isn't a reloading press for a beginner. Having said that, if you are an experienced reloader and have a desire to own your own ammunition factory, then you need THIS PRESS. If you buy a different brand (red, orange, or green brand, for example) then THAT mistake is on YOU. In the world of progressive reloading, there is Dillon, and there is everything else. Reliable, sturdy, the best warranty in the world, and it is the standard by which progressive reloading presses are judged. I owned an RCBS "Green Machine" back in the early 80s, and have been using progressive presses since then. I've owned that, an RCBS RockChucker single stage, a Bonanza Co-Ax single stage, 2 separate Dillon Square Deal "B"s, a Dillon RL550, and the XL650 that I have now, so I have some basis of knowledge on which to make these assertions. I reload for 6 pistol calibers, and calibers can be changed in a matter of minutes. Buy this, or regret it. ... show more

  • Powder measure drops powder all over press, small amounts but enough
I like how it looks, feels and just a really great looking press. I was frustrated setting it up had to watch videos a few times, they leave out some pain points in the videos. Overall once you get it going it is really nice. My main issues I have been having is primers getting stuck once in a while. But really what bothers me the most is the powder leaking after the round comes down. It begins to sprinkle powder over the press. I have had multiple emails with Dillon and done everything they asked to the point where they had nothing else. I hear online that buying two springs or rubber bands will solve this but after spending 875 on the press alone we shouldn't have to do that. Dillon has yet to respond to my request to send me the springs and they are 7 dollars each plus over 10 dollars shipping. These should be included when paying so much for a piece of equipment. Overall I should have purchased another quality press and loaded just a bit slower and saved 400 to use on other parts or even purchasing a new rifle with that kind of savings. ... show more
